Deluge stands out from other BitTorrent clients thanks to its daemon/client functionality. A daemon is an application that runs in the background of your computer and it doesn’t have a visible interface. Since these programs don’t require a graphical interface to operate, they can be controlled by multiple clients (user-interfaces) and also over the network. Deluge offers three main interfaces: the standard graphical one, a web-based interface accessible from the browser and an interface that works by typing commands. Having these alternative interfaces can make your experience more flexible as you can choose how you want to manage your downloads.

Another benefit of Deluge is that unlike other clients, it is not plagued with ads. It also features RSS via plugin, mainline DHT, libtorrent support, password protection and private torrents. Main security concerns for Torrent users

There is a risk that others can see your torrent activity. When you use a torrent client such as Deluge, your IP address can be seen by every peer in the torrent swarm. In addition, your ISP is capable of monitoring your activity and get access to the data that you download. Your IP address is a unique number that is assigned to you by your ISP and other can use it to identify you. Websites like ipchicken.com and whatismyipaddress.com give you the chance to find out what is your IP address.

Your IP address is public and unless you use a tool to mask it, others will be able to see it, which gives them the possibility of finding out details such as your location and ISP. When you join a torrent swarm, all the peers in that swarm will be able to see your IP address. In order to see the IP addresses of your peers, all you need to do is to launch Deluge, select an active torrent and click on the Peers tab. Given that it is very easy to find out the IP address of your peers and that in most cases, there are thousands of peers in a swarm, it is important to consider using a tool that helps you to keep your real IP address hidden.

The fact that your IP address can be seen by your peers is not the only reason why you need to take measures to enhance your privacy. Your Internet Service Provider has the capacity of monitoring and throttling your torrent activity. All your outgoing and incoming traffic passes your ISP’s servers, meaning that they can see everything you do when you are connected to the internet. They can see and log your browsing history, the applications you use (including bittorrent), the files that you download and upload, the amount of data transferred and more. Fortunately, there is a way to prevent this. By using a VPN service, you can keep your online activities private and prevent your ISP and other parties from keeping track of what you do on the internet.

Securing Deluge with a VPN

While a VPN may slow down the speed of your connection, it is the bets option when it comes to keeping your torrent activities secure. When you use a VPN, your torrents are routed through the same tunnel as the rest of your data. Your real IP address is hidden and both your torrent and your browser IP address are masked with the IP address of the VPN server. An alternative solution is using a proxy, but this doesn’t encrypt your traffic. The encryption applied by a VPN scrambles your data so your ISP and other parries won’t find out what you are doing.

Another advantage of the encryption that you get from a VPN is that it can prevent your ISP from throttling your connection. Proxy servers help you to enjoy better speeds, but they lack the additional layer of protection that a VPN offers. Still, if you want to get the advantages of these two technologies, you can find use a proxy server in combination with a VPN. Some VPN providers even include a proxy service with their subscription.
